2025 Draft Strategy
The Cardinals enter the 2025 NFL Draft with few clear needs. The team has the basic pieces needed to win the NFC West this fall. Arizona has the QB, RBs, WRs, TEs that match up well with any team in the NFC. The OL could use an upgrade and should get attention early in the draft. Selecting with the 16th pick overall, the Cardinals would have their choice amongst a fine OT crop including, Josh Conerly (Oregon), Josh Simmons (Ohio State), and Jonah Savaiinaea (Arizona) or possibly selecting the first IOL off the board in Tyler Booker (Alabama) or Grey Zabel (North Dakota State). Similarly, the defense has plenty of depth but could use a difference maker to create havoc - and turnovers - in the secondary. Jahdae Barron (Texas), Maxwell Hairston (Kentucky), and Quincy Riley (Louisville) make intriguing options in the first round. Adding Josh Sweat in free agency was a boon for the pass rush but another impact rusher off the edge would be a great asset to add in the mid rounds in Green Bay later this month. This year's safety class offers many quality prospects and selecting one on Saturday afternoon would improve the defense's speed and deep coverage ability.
